As he grew older, his faith in God grew and he participated in many church activities and mission trips. He was accepted into West Point with the class of 2008, where he graduated 6th in his class. After college, Chris was commissioned as an infantry officer and complete Airborne School and Army Ranger School.
Chris married the love of his life, Kelsey, and they settled into life together at Fort Bragg, NC, where Chris joined Charlie Company, 1st Battalion, 508th Parachute Infantry Regiment on May 18, 2009.
In September 2009, Chris deployed with his unit to Afghanistan and would lead a platoon in combat.On Tuesday, July 13, 2010, Chris was killed in action while repelling an insurgent attack on an Afghan police compound in Kandahar City. 10 years after his death, we come together to remember Chris and honor his lasting impact on our lives.
